The Case of the Killer Chipset: Performance and Gaming Prowess

The iQOO Neo 10 5G is strutting its stuff, and it’s not hard to see why. This contender is making waves, consistently earning shout-outs across the tech scene. The secret weapon? The Snapdragon 8s Gen 4 chipset. Sounds fancy, right? It is! This silicon powerhouse is a significant upgrade, promising a serious boost in performance compared to older models. We’re talking faster processing, smoother graphics, and an overall snappier experience. This is crucial if you’re a gamer. Those demanding titles need some serious horsepower under the hood, and the Snapdragon 8s Gen 4 delivers. But it’s not just for gamers, folks. Video editing? No problem. Running multiple apps at once? Piece of cake. This chipset makes the iQOO Neo 10 a multitasking monster.

And let’s not forget the screen, a dazzling 6.78-inch AMOLED display with a silky-smooth 144Hz refresh rate. Translation: everything looks gorgeous and feels incredibly responsive. Scrolling through your social feeds? Feels like butter. Watching videos? Prepare to be immersed. Gaming? Get ready for unparalleled fluidity. And with a sharp 1260p resolution, every detail pops, making the viewing experience truly next-level. To keep the party going, iQOO threw in a beefy 5000mAh battery. That’s enough juice to get you through a full day of heavy use, which is a *huge* selling point for many users. Nobody wants their phone dying halfway through the day, especially when you’re trying to conquer the virtual battlefield or binge-watch your favorite show.

The inclusion of Type-C ports is a small but important detail that shouldn’t be overlooked. It signifies a commitment to modern connectivity standards and user convenience. Type-C ports are faster, more versatile, and more durable than older Micro-USB ports. They allow for faster data transfer speeds, faster charging, and even the ability to connect to external displays and other accessories. They’re a definite victory for simplicity.

The availability of multiple RAM and storage options is another key consideration. The more RAM you have, the more apps you can run simultaneously without experiencing slowdowns. And with a 256GB internal memory, users can pack tons of games. Storage space is another crucial factor, especially if you plan on storing a lot of photos, videos, and games on your phone. Nobody wants to constantly be deleting files to make room for new ones. The iQOO Neo 9 Pro with 12GB RAM and Neo 7 Pro with 256GB storage options cover both concerns.
